      <title>burny says "The elliptical doesn't hurt my knees like a treadmill" about Elliptical vs. Treadmill Comparison</title>
      <link>http://www.viewpoints.com/Elliptical-vs-Treadmill-Comparison-review-864c2</link>
      <description>Using the elliptical machine gives my joints the rest they need from the daily pounding from running.&#160; I hook up my iPod to my ears and go.&#160; Plus with the multiple styles of workouts available&#160;I can concentrate on the type&#160;of workout I need that day.&#160; You can focus on the upperbody, or lowerbody as you need it.&#160; With a treadmill you can only run or walk.&#160; I enjoy being able to mix the elliptical and treadmill workout, but when my knees are bothering me, I can always exercise on the elliptical without pain.&#160; Both have their pros, but I can't find any cons with the elliptical.... </description>

      <title>burny says "It's difficult to use, and doesn't always take programming." about Honeywell Programmable Electronic Thermostat</title>
      <link>http://www.viewpoints.com/Honeywell-Programmable-Electronic-Thermostat-review-22e71</link>
      <description>While this product has the ability to save money and energy, it is not user friendly.&#160; It isn't as easy as 1, 2, 3.&#160; It also doesn't regulate to the whole house, wherever the thermostat is, it determines the temperature.&#160; Some rooms may be warmer based on the temperature that you program it to, others will be too cold.&#160; I much rather prefer to have a single setting thermostat.... </description>
